Pilot Assembly Replacement in Waxahachie
Pilot assembly replacement swaps the full pilot unit — pilot hood, thermocouple/thermopile, and igniter — when the pilot won't stay lit. It's the most common fix for a gas fireplace that lights then dies.

Common signs in Waxahachie homes
- Pilot lights but goes out when you release the knob
- Weak, yellow, or wandering pilot flame
- Igniter clicks but won't catch
- Thermocouple/thermopile reads low

Pilot Assembly Replacement in Waxahachie — FAQ
How do I know the assembly needs replacing, not just cleaning?
If the pilot won't hold after the orifice is cleaned, the flame is weak or lifting off, or the igniter sparks but the gas never catches, the thermocouple or pilot hood is usually shot. A tech measures thermocouple millivolt output (a healthy one reads around 25-30 mV open-circuit) to confirm before quoting a full swap.
Can I replace a pilot assembly myself?
It's not advisable. The assembly connects to the gas line and the safety shut-off circuit, and the pilot flame has to be aimed precisely at the thermocouple or the valve won't stay open. A licensed tech also leak-tests the connections afterward, which a DIY swap usually skips. Parts cost varies a lot by appliance model.
How long does a new pilot assembly last?
A thermocouple typically lasts 5-10 years; the igniter and orifice often outlast it. Soot, drafts, LP gas impurities, and a flame that's slightly mis-aimed all shorten thermocouple life. An annual check catches a weakening thermocouple before it strands you on a cold night.
Why does my pilot keep dying even with a new thermocouple?
A fresh thermocouple won't fix a clogged pilot orifice, a draft pulling the flame off the sensor tip, low gas pressure, or a failing valve magnet. That's why a tech checks flame envelope and inlet pressure rather than just swapping the part, and replaces the full assembly when the hood and orifice are also worn.
